What services does Fairmount Behavioral Health System offer?

Fairmount Behavioral Health System provides a wide array of services designed to meet the diverse needs of individuals struggling with mental health challenges and substance use disorders. Their approach is holistic, recognizing that mental well-being is intricately connected to physical and emotional health. This often includes, but is not limited to:

  • Inpatient Treatment: For individuals requiring intensive, around-the-clock care, inpatient programs offer a structured environment to stabilize symptoms and begin the healing process. These programs often incorporate evidence-based therapies and medication management.

  • Outpatient Treatment: Outpatient services provide ongoing support and therapy for individuals who are able to maintain their daily lives while receiving treatment. This might involve individual or group therapy, medication management, and case management services.

  • Partial Hospitalization Programs (PHP): PHP programs offer a step-down approach from inpatient care, providing a structured, intensive daytime program while allowing individuals to return home in the evenings. This is often a crucial bridge between inpatient care and the transition back to daily life.

  •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P): IOPs are less intensive than PHPs, offering support and therapy for individuals needing less structured care but still requiring regular engagement in the recovery process.

  • Medication Management: Skilled psychiatrists provide comprehensive medication management to help alleviate symptoms and stabilize individuals' mental health.

  • Therapy: A range of therapeutic approaches, including c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), and others, are utilized to help individuals develop coping skills, process trauma, and build resilience.

What types of mental health conditions does Fairmount Behavioral Health System treat?

Fairmount Behavioral Health System offers specialized treatment for a broad spectrum of mental health conditions, adapting their approach to meet the unique needs of each individual. The conditions treated frequently include, but are not limited to:

  • Depression: From mild to severe, depression is a significant challenge, and Fairmount provides treatment options ranging from therapy to medication management.

  • Anxiety Disorders: Various anxiety disorders, including generalized anxiety disorder, panic disorder, and social anxiety disorder, receive specialized attention.

  • Trauma-Related Disorders: Post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) and other trauma-related conditions are treated with trauma-informed care, recognizing the profound impact of trauma on mental well-being.

  • Bipolar Disorder: Individuals experiencing the highs and lows of bipolar disorder find support and stabilization through medication management and therapy.

  • Substance Use Disorders: Fairmount addresses substance use disorders through comprehensive treatment programs that combine medication-assisted treatment (MAT), therapy, and support groups.
